Oh, I love talking about books and finding ways to read them! 'Taylor Before and After' is such a heartfelt story—I remember being so moved by it. If you're looking to read it online for free, you might want to check if your local library offers digital lending through apps like Libby or OverDrive. Libraries often have e-book copies you can borrow legally. Some platforms also offer limited free previews, like Google Books or Amazon's 'Look Inside' feature, but for the full book, supporting the author by purchasing or borrowing is the best way to go.

I totally get the appeal of free reads, especially when budgets are tight, but indie authors and publishers really rely on sales. If you're passionate about books, maybe consider recommending it to your library—they might add it to their collection! Either way, it's a gem worth experiencing.

Where can I read The Poems of Edward Taylor online for free?

8 Answers2025-12-10 00:25:16
I stumbled upon Edward Taylor's poetry during a late-night deep dive into colonial American literature. His work is hauntingly beautiful, blending Puritan theology with vivid imagery. While full collections are often behind paywalls, you can find selected poems on sites like Poetry Foundation or Project Gutenberg. I remember reading 'Meditation 8' on the former—it’s a great starting point. Libraries sometimes offer free digital access too, so check your local catalog! If you’re into obscure archives, the Internet Archive occasionally has scanned editions. Just search for 'Edward Taylor poems' and filter by 'texts.' It’s not the most user-friendly, but the treasure hunt is part of the fun. Some academic sites like JSTOR offer limited free reads if you register, though they focus more on analysis than primary texts.
